1965 Avanti Avanti vs. 1984 Renault 5

To start off, 1984 Renault 5 is newer by 19 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1965 Avanti Avanti.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1965 Avanti Avanti would be higher. At 5,354 cc (8 cylinders), 1965 Avanti Avanti is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1965 Avanti Avanti (254 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 96 more horse power than 1984 Renault 5. (158 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1965 Avanti Avanti should accelerate faster than 1984 Renault 5.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1965 Avanti Avanti weights approximately 490 kg more than 1984 Renault 5.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1965 Avanti Avanti (488 Nm @ 3400 RPM) has 267 more torque (in Nm) than 1984 Renault 5. (221 Nm @ 3250 RPM). This means 1965 Avanti Avanti will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1984 Renault 5.
